At-Home Insemination IRL: Checklist, ICI Steps, and Timing
Before you try at home insemination, run this quick checklist: Timing plan: you know how you’ll estimate ovulation (OPKs, cervical mucus, BBT, or a combo). Supplies ready: clean, needleless syringe; collection cup; towels; optional lube labeled fertility-friendly. Donor logistics: fresh vs. frozen, transport time, and clear communication.
